Output e66b31c9a92677dc65e3264b4f8e12bb6036a026400197e12fc39cb1dd67460c:1

value
3237433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ffa5830dc8bc0cde8c7a80da33ef9b7dafece6f3 OP_EQUAL
address
3QzkWRwyRAh6Hoi9PEQALG9sFJBdmyuEbu
transaction
e66b31c9a92677dc65e3264b4f8e12bb6036a026400197e12fc39cb1dd67460c
spent
true